Ticket: Unlock migration vault for Ironvine ORM refactor

New team members: the legacy Ironvine ORM layer is being replaced module by module, and the schema snapshots needed for safe refactoring sit in a locked vault nobody has opened since the last owner left. We recovered the credentials from escrow this week. The passphrase follows below.

unlock words, kajog-yawip: istwyn-casath-aldok

16:05 — The Marrowgate audit-log viewer began returning empty result sets for all tenants. The cause was a schema migration that renamed the events table without updating the viewer's query layer. No audit data was lost; only display was affected. The rollback build that restored service is identified by the token below.

session token of tajef-bageg = htk21_5d90d574934f3ccae6437

Subject: Handover — Hollyford partner drop

Hey team, quick handover before the sync. The weekly Hollyford partner SFTP drop is now automated, but the signing step is still manual until the cron fix lands. Just run the packager, verify the manifest checksum, and sign before upload — their side rejects unsigned bundles. The key you'll need for signing is pasted below.

deploy key for yajeg-hahog: bky3_BZq

## Reviewing Catalogue Import PRs

Welcome! The Inkspool catalogue importer pulls nightly record batches from the Harrowgate library system and normalises them into our shelf schema. When reviewing import changes, watch for two things: field-mapping edits (they must stay backwards compatible with last quarter's batches) and anything touching the dedupe pass, which is fragile around multi-volume sets. The mapping spec, test fixtures, and the reviewer checklist are all kept on the internal page below.

wiki page, tahaf-tajog: https://jira.ordindyn.corp/pipeline